https://www.ventusky.com seems to do the best job as it relates to wind. It gives you both wind speed and wind gusts. (For future visitors, I'm currently tracking Hurricane Irma)
Both https://earth.nullschool.net and https://www.windy.com don't appear to have options for wind gusts. So the wind speeds appear much lower than what all the news agencies are reporting right now (180-185mph peak). I get a high of about 75mph in the eye.
windy.com also forces you to register in order to save settings. A bit odd since their Android app doesn't request this AND it's also free of ads and Google Frameworks requirements.
Nullschool doesn't appear to have a settings section at all except for changing language. So metric only...
My fav right now is VentuSky. Sadly... no Android app. I'm not aware of any other similar ones.
